Sending big cargo boxes takes different amounts of time. Small boxes travel very fast on an airplane. A huge, heavy box takes more days because it must travel on a slow cargo ship across the ocean. When the box arrives in your country, the border police must look inside it first to make sure it is safe. Then, the local truck driver brings it to your front door.
When you look up your secret code, you will see a few short words. Here is what they are trying to tell you.
Order Received: The worker took your cargo box from the sender.
In Transit: Your package is riding in a truck or boat to a new city today.
Customs Check: The border workers are checking the papers on your box.
Out for Delivery: The delivery driver put your box in his car this morning.
Delivered: Your box is finally safe at your home.

Sometimes cargo is very late. Here are a few normal reasons why.
Very bad ocean storms can stop the cargo boats from moving fast.
A bad address makes it very hard for the delivery driver to find your exact house.
Border checks can stop your box for many days if the workers have too much work.
